Join Allied Universal as an unarmed patrol officer in a residential community location, where you will conduct routine patrols, remain visible to help deter security-related incidents, and support residents with outstanding customer service and communication. Requirements

  • Be at least 18 years of age for unarmed roles; 21+ years of age for armed roles.
  • Possess a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a background investigation in accordance with all federal, state, and local laws.
  • Allied Universal will consider qualified applications with criminal histories in a manner consistent with applicable laws.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a drug screen to the extent permitted by law.
  • Licensing requirements are subject to state and/or local laws and regulations and may be required prior to employment.
  • A valid driver’s license will be required for driving positions only.

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to residents, guests, and/or vendors by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ities.
  • Respond to incidents, disturbances, and/or crit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ner and report relevant details according to site protocols.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ols throughout the residential location, including common areas, parking areas, amenities, and perimeter points as assigned.
  • Monitor access to the property and help to deter unauthorized entry, suspicious activity, and/or policy violations through observation and routine presence.
  • Document daily activities, unusual occurrences, and/or maintenance-related concerns, and communicate with residents and property management when appropriate.
